нетиповая конфигурация 1с что это
Нетиповая конфигурация 1с что это
« Как стать программистом 1С » Настройка 1С » Обновление нетиповой конфигурации 1С
Обновление нетиповой конфигурации 1С
В прошлый раз мы обсуждали, как провести обновление 1С типовой конфигурации.
Обновление 1С производится нажатием «одной» кнопки, типовая конфигурация сама может скачать обновление 1С и установить его. От пользователя потребуется ввести только регистрационные данные.
Что делать, если конфигурация нетиповая? Или типовая, но в ней выполнены доработки – добавлен справочник, пару реквизитов, отчет?
Ответ на этот вопрос мы узнаем сегодня.
Что такое нетиповая конфигурация 1С
Нетиповая конфигурация 1С, это когда:
При обновлении 1С нетиповой конфигурации, снятой с поддержки, 1С предложит «поставить нетиповую конфигурацию на поддержку» обратно. Тогда все изменения будут аннулированы (стерты).
Для того, чтобы при обновлении 1С нетиповой (измененной) конфигурации 1С, изменения остались, а обновлении 1С применилось – можно использовать другой режим обновления 1С.
Посмотрим на пример измененной конфигурации, которую мы хотим обновить. Это типовая конфигурация 1С Бухгалтерия (слева), в которую внесены изменения (справа):
1) В справочник «Номенклатура» добавили реквизит «Мой реквизит». Вывели его на форму вместо реквизита «Полное наименование» (а значит — изменили форму)
2) Добавили справочник «Новый справочник»
3) В справочнике «Электронные представления..» удалили несколько реквизитов
4) В справочнике «Физические лица», в модуле формы, в функции ПрочитатьМестоРождения() добавили строчку программы
Как сработают все эти изменения в момент обновления 1С нетиповой конфигурации 1С?
Обновление 1С с сохранением изменений нетиповой конфигурации 1С
Обновление 1С конфигурации обычно распространяются в виде самораспаковывающегося архива. После распаковки нужно запустить файл установки, чтобы установить обновление 1С на компьютер (не в 1С!).
При установке обновления Вы выбираете куда будет установлено обновление 1С. Обычно это типовая папка для хранения шаблонов tmplts. Вы можете установить в любую другую папку на диске, а 1С указать, где находятся файлы с обновлением 1С.
Файлы обновления 1С могут быть следующего вида:
Оба файла хранятся в каталоге обновлений 1С, в папке с наименованием версии.
Будьте внимательнее при использовании файла CFU – он позволяет обновить только с определенной версии на определенную!
Итак, для обновления 1С выберите один из вариантов пунктов меню:
Первым делом 1С сравнит две конфигурации. Конфигурация Вашей базы данных называется «Основная конфигурация», а конфигурация из обновления – «Конфигурация из файла».
1С отобразит все различия в виде привычного дерева объектов конфигурации 1С, где справа отображены изменения.
Посмотрите – на нашем примере, выделены справочники, которые были изменены или добавлены.
Так как мы обновляем 1С нетиповую конфигурацию, которая была изменена – то есть когда-то она была типовой, необходимо ввести некоторые настройки.
Нажмите кнопку Настройка. Выберите «Загружаемая конфигурация является потомком основной» (то есть является измененной типовой).
Галочка «Разрешить удаление объектов основной конфигурации» позволяет удалять объекты конфигурации 1С, если они удалены в обновлении 1С. Так как мы добавляли в конфигурацию реквизиты и справочники, а в обновлении 1С их нет, то 1С будет считать, что в обновлении 1С они удалены. Поэтому не надо ставить эту галочку.
Рассмотрим обнаруженные платформой различия внимательно.
1) Добавили реквизит «Мой реквизит». Вывели его на форму вместо реквизита «Полное наименование» (а значит — изменили форму)
Раскроем ветку справочника Номенклатура. В ветке Реквизиты мы видим, что в типовой конфигурации отсутствует реквизит, а мы его добавляем. Минус значит, что он будет удален.
Так как нам не нужно, чтобы был удален реквизит, который мы сами добавляли, нужно сделать следующее (варианты):
Также у справочника Номенклатура была изменена форма. 1С это увидела и показывает нам в списке измененных объектов форму справочника тоже.
Чтобы посмотреть какие изменения сделаны на форме, можно сделать следующее (варианты):
Отчет о сравнении объектов, при сравнении форм, показывает много различий. Это связано с тем, что когда мы добавляем всего лишь одно поле на форму – автоматически производится изменение множества смежных элементов – отступов, привязок и т.п.
В списке изменений мы видим наши изменения – изменения надписи и замену поля.
Мы можем согласиться или отказаться от изменения формы выбором галочки возле нее. Это влечет за собой следующие последствия:
а) если мы ставим галочку
б) если мы не ставим галочку
Можно использовать третий вариант. Раскройте ветку Форма до конца и в колонке «Режим объединения» выберите «Объединить».
в) если мы выбрали «Объединить»
2) В справочнике «Физические лица», в модуле формы, в функции ПрочитатьМестоРождения() добавили строчку программы
Чтобы посмотреть изменения в модуле формы, которые обнаружила 1С, раскроем ветку формы до конца, нажмем на нее правой кнопкой, выберем пункт меню «Показать различия в модулях».
Изменения показываются в разрезе каждой функции, но при этом режиме просмотра можно или выбрать обновление 1С всего модуля или отказаться от него.
Другой способ – это использовать кнопку лупы в этой строчке.
Тогда мы не только увидим изменения в разрезе каждой функции, но и можем с помощью галочек выбирать какую функцию мы хотим обновить, а какую нет.
3) В справочнике «Электронные представления..» удалили несколько реквизитов
1С определила, что мы удалили реквизиты типового справочника и предлагает нам их восстановить.
4) Добавили справочник «Новый справочник»
Справочник же, нами добавленный, 1С предлагает удалить. В этом случае действует то же правило, что и в случае с добавленным нами реквизитом (см. ранее).
Итак, наша задача – внимательно изучить обнаруженные 1С изменения и с помощью галочек согласиться на них или отказаться. После этого нажимайте кнопку Выполнить.
Обратите внимание, что если Вы удалили реквизит в результате обновления 1С, то удалили и данные, которые были в него внесены пользователями, а значит повторное добавление того же реквизита не восстановит эти данные.
Если в конфигурации есть несколько связанных объектов – например реквизит и форма; при этом Вы разрешили обновление 1С формы, но сняли галочку с реквизита, то наступает противоречие.
После нажатия кнопки Выполнить, 1С находит такие ситуации и сообщает от них.
После нажатия на кнопку Выполнить у Вас остается еще одна возможность подумать.
Чтобы подтвердить проведенное обновление 1С – нужно выбрать пункт меню Конфигурация/Обновить конфигурацию базы данных.
Чтобы отказаться от обновления 1С – нужно выбрать пункт меню Конфигурация/Вернуться к конфигурации БД.
Третий вариант (указана последовательность пунктов меню):
Таким образом Вы полученную объединенную конфигурацию выгружаете в файл, а от изменений отказываетесь. Вы можете проанализировать полученную конфигурацию, внести ручные правки, а позже просто загрузить ее с помощью меню Конфигурация/Загрузить конфигурацию из файла.
Типовая и нетиповая конфигурации 1С. Как отличить?
Автоматизированная система 1С: Предприятие 8 является адаптивным решением, которое помогает оптимизировать основные бизнес-процессы. По факту, программа способна помочь как начинающим предпринимателям с небольшим количеством сотрудников, так и крупным организациям с большим числом филиалов и подразделений в городе, стране и по всему миру. Такую гибкость разработчикам удалось достичь за счет комбинации различных инструментов 1С.
Конфигурация 1С – это разработка, которая была создана представителями фирмы 1С и ее партнерами. Специалисты время от времени обновляют программы, чтобы адаптировать их под потребности бизнеса и расширять функционал.
Также любую типовую конфигурацию можно отличить от нетиповой. Например, если:
Если говорить о нетиповой конфигурации, то важно понимать, что здесь обновить программу автоматически не выйдет, придется воспользоваться услугами специалистов, которые готовы сделать это вручную. Длительность и сложность процедуры напрямую связана с тем, какие коррективы необходимо внести.
Чтобы понять, конфигурация является типовой или нетиповой, необходимо следовать инструкции:
Многие ошибочно полагают, что иконка замочка рядом с наименованием конфигурации свидетельствует о том, что прикладное решение является типовым, но это не так. Он символизирует только то, что основные функции и опции разработки остались теми же.
Основные виды конфигурации 1С — что это
Конфигураций системы 1С существует великое множество. Они могут быть как универсальными, так и приспособленными для потребностей конкретного предприятия, и даже быть специализированными — профессиональными или корпоративными.
Что это такое: Конфигурации 1С
Конфигурации 1С — это прикладные решения от компании 1С, выполненные в виде программ, автоматизирующих деятельность организаций и частных лиц. Они запускаются только при наличии технологической платформы 1С:Предприятие.
Фирма-разработчик решений для автоматизации
Важно! Без специальной среды (оболочки) запускаться и работать прикладные решения не будут.
Главные функции
Набор предоставляемых возможностей всецело зависит от целевого предназначения. Например, если конфигурация создана для бухгалтерии, она будет охватывать вопросы учета и подготовки отчетности. Для управления кадровыми вопросами также предусмотрена своя отдельная наработка. Вместе с тем, если решение предназначается, к примеру, для розничной торговли, его использование на производственном предприятии будет сопровождаться затруднениями. Вот что такое Конфигурация 1С в общих чертах.
1С:Предприятие — платформа для различных решений
Основные виды конфигурация 1С
Программа, созданная 1С, имеет статус «типовой». Франчайзи при этом могут создавать свои собственные наработки, которые классифицируются как «Конфигурация 1С»: это вполне легально и не запрещается законом. Более того, они даже продаются через сеть 1С. Правда, такое программное обеспечение имеет статус «нетипового».
Любая компания имеет право на создание собственного программного решения в 1С. Это должно быть сделано с нуля — тогда она может распространяться самостоятельно фирмой. В случае, если создаётся модификация или берётся часть кода из другой наработки 1С, следует получить разрешение у компании. Для этого проходится сертификация «1С:Совместимо». Разрешение действует 2 года.
Дополнительная информация! Первоначально сертификация проводится бесплатно, с третьей попытки — платно.
Получить признание не сложно для конфигурации 1С: что это даст кроме улучшенных условий для распространения? Не будет проблем связанных с использованием результатов чужого интеллектуального труда, можно легально и не скрываясь заниматься реализацией созданной разработки. Для сертификации нужно соответствовать следующим требованиям:
Это не полный список требований, а только базовый перечень. Периодически проводят его обновление и ориентироваться желательно на свежую информацию от 1С. Впрочем, если соблюдены перечисленные требования, проблемы, как правило, не возникают.
Конфигурация для работы с заработной платой и управления персоналом
Типовые решения
А теперь о конкретных представителях. Когда рассмотрено, что такое Конфигурация в 1С, можно обратиться и к частным случаям реализации. Начинать следует с типовых разработок, предлагаемых фирмой-разработчиком. И открывает список следующая конфигурация:
Дополнительная информация! Вот такие типовые конфигурации 1С предлагаются для предприятий. Только ими дело не ограничивается — существует ещё большое число разработок, что не были упомянуты.
Это и консолидация, и библиотеки стандартных подсистем, и отраслевые конфигурации, и центр управления производительностью — перечень можно продолжать долго. Существуют самые разнообразие виды конфигураций 1С. И в этом убедит следующий пункт статьи.
Конфигурация для управления торговлей
Нетиповые решения
Каждая компания с платформой 1С:Предприятие может создавать свои собственные наработки, благо, сделать это относительно не сложно. А это значит, что большое количество коммерческий структур подгоняют типовые конфигурации под свои конкретные условия. Иногда, они решают не ограничиваться только своим предприятием, а предлагают другим фирмам воспользоваться их наработками.
А это означает, что появляется дополнительный рынок программного обеспечения.
Дополнительная информация! Если типичная организация не удовлетворяется решениями от «1С», она может поискать среди конфигураций от других предприятий.
А сейчас будет рассмотрено, что не является типовой конфигурацией 1С:Предприятия, но позволяет обеспечивать функционирование компании:
Для 1С:Предприятие конфигурации разработчиков только по программе сотрудничества «1С:Совместимо» насчитывают более 800 различных предложений! Основа для всего комплекса программного обеспечения одна и та же, поэтому, на чем бы не остановился выбор, объект будет качественным.
При этом можно не ограничиваться только сертифицированными дополнениями, а и, на свой страх и риск, воспользоваться кустарными наработками. Но обращаться к такому варианту следует только с резервной базой данных и умелыми руками.
Область применения конфигураций 1С
Релиз различных наработок осуществляется едва ли не каждую неделю, а если учесть разнообразие несертифицированных вариантов, то чуть ли не каждый день. Обусловлено это востребованностью платформы 1С:Предприятие и потребностью в предлагаемом программном обеспечении. Возможностей использования конфигураций 1С существует великое множество:
И ещё много других вариантов.
Конфигурации предоставляют широкие возможности для улучшения результативности предприятия. Но просто их установить мало. Следует ещё и научиться их использованию с должным уровнем эффективности.
Обновление нетиповой конфигурации 1С 8.3 — инструкция по шагам
Обновление нетиповой, сильно измененной конфигурации — очень трудоёмкая и ответственная задача. Обычно обновление релиза производится для конфигураций, содержащих блок регламентированной отчетности. Например, 1С Бухгалтерия 8.3, Комплексная автоматизация, Управление производственным предприятием, Зарплата и управление персоналом.
Рассмотрим, как проще всего и без ошибок сделать нетиповое обновление, на примере конфигурации 1С Бухгалтерия предприятия.
Начало любого обновления описано в статье типовое обновление 1С. Мы же будем рассматривать только самое главное — нюансы нетипового обновления.
Немного теории о нетиповых конфигурациях:
Инструкция по обновлению
1. Подготовка к обновлению
Перед началом всех действий убедитесь, что конфигурация поставщика соответствует основной конфигурации, — это существенно облегчит нетиповое обновление. Если конфигурация поставщика имеет более раннюю версию, значит, конфигурация ранее обновлялась неправильно. Обновить релиз поставщика можно, поочередно запуская обновление и не выбирая для сравнения ни одного объекта.
Первым делом я разворачиваю 2 базы с первоначальной конфигурацией. Одну для внесения изменения, вторую для сравнения с новой.
Если Ваша конфигурация не типовая, то по нажатию кнопки «обновить» в конфигураторе система начнет сравнение основной и новой конфигурации поставщика:
Внешне кажется, что у нас изменилось большое количество объектов. Однако представим ситуацию: Вы изменяли документ, но он не менялся в текущем релизе 1С конфигурации — нужно ли его обновлять вручную? Конечно, нет. Для отбора таких объектов после сравнения обязательно нажмите кнопку Фильтр и поставьте галку Показывать дважды измененные свойства:
После фильтрации мы видим, что измененных объектов стало гораздо меньше:
Мы получили список объектов, над которыми будем работать. В нашем случае оказался всего один сложный объект — документ ЗаписьКУДиР.
2. Перенос изменений обновления 1С
Для переноса изменений я открываю 2 конфигуратора — в одном запускаю сравнения и забираю изменения, а во втором — произвожу доработки.
Следующий этап — непосредственно перенос изменений. Рассмотрим основные приемы при обновления нетиповых конфигураций.
3. Различия в модулях
Достаточно простая, но очень ответственная операция — мы просто переносим модули из нового релиза в старый. Если код комментируется, то проблем быть не должно:
4. Сравнения форм и макетов
Тут процесс гораздо сложнее. Вам необходимо отловить малейшие изменения на формах. Рекомендую формировать подробный отчет о различиях с графическим отражением:
После того как Вы перенесли из новой конфигурации все изменения объектов, запустите сравнение и объединение заново, сняв для сравнения объекты, которые Вы изменяли вручную.
Нетиповое обновление измененной конфигурации 1С завершено!
Обратите внимание! Если Вы не умеете программировать в 1С 8, шанс на успешное обновление нетиповой конфигурации крайне мал. Вы потратите много времени и в итоге получите конфигурацию, которая даже не запускается. Рекомендую обратиться для оперативной помощи к специалисту по 1С.
Другие статьи по 1С:
Видео упрощенного обновления:
К сожалению, мы физически не можем проконсультировать бесплатно всех желающих, но наша команда будет рада оказать услуги по внедрению и обслуживанию 1С. Более подробно о наших услугах можно узнать на странице Услуги 1С или просто позвоните по телефону +7 (499) 350 29 00. Мы работаем в Москве и области.
Чем отличается нетиповая конфигурация 1С от типовой
Чтобы решение бизнес-задач в коммерческих организациях было более быстрым и успешным, компаниями различных сфер деятельности применяются платформы 1С. Это гибкие и многофункциональные программные продукты, с помощью которых можно автоматизировать практически любой рабочий процесс.
Программный продукт, разработанный непосредственно компанией «1С» или ее партнерами, носит название типовой конфигурации. Программы данного типа проходят обязательную сертификацию и систематически обновляются. В отличие от типовых программных продуктов, нетиповые:
Конфигурация 1С переходит в категорию нетиповых даже после незначительных доработок, внесенных в ее программу.
От того, к какой категории относится конфигурация, зависит порядок перехода программы на обновленную версию. Типовые конфигурации обновляются автоматически или полуавтоматически, а обновлением нетиповых занимаются профессионалы 1С. При этом сложность их работы определяется качеством и количеством новшеств, изменивших конфигурацию.
Определение нетиповой конфигурации включает этапы:
Стоит отметить, что изображение замка возле названия конфигурации не служит подтверждением ее «типичности», а говорит, что в корневые свойства программы 1С изменения не вносились (но другие ее объекты и характеристики менять допустимо).